Harvey M. Powers

Professor of English, Director of Theatre 1949 – 1987

In 1949, the first theatre faculty member, Harvey M. Powers, is hired in the English Department.  Professor Powers teaches the first fully accredited courses in acting; directing; and theatre history and criticism.  The theatre concentration within the English Major is developed with the inclusion of Shakespeare and dramatic literature courses taught by several English professors. By 1976, the theatre major is established within the English Department.  Fellow English Professors Anthony Gosse and Dennis Baumwoll sometimes act in Cap and Dagger plays.  The interdisciplinary connections across for the campus community flourish.  The Department of Theatre is established in 1985 and becomes The Department of Theatre and Dance in 1986.

Guest artist residencies and guest directors were essential to the vitality of the Theatre Program.  A sampling from this early period is impressive and speaks to Bucknell’s support for the performing arts and the professional connections of Harvey M. Powers and his colleagues.  

Etienne De Croix – Mime

Lucia Victor – Director

Alan Schneider – Director

Jean Rosenthal – Lighting Designer

Tharon Musser – Lighting Designer

Nananne Porcher – Lighting Designer

Oliver Smith –  Set Designer

Fernando Arrabal – Playwright

Leonard Malfi – Playwright

Edward Albee – Playwright

Judith Anderson – Actress

Jack Palance – Actor

Richard Waring – Actor

Michael Miller – Actor

Joe Chaikin – Actor

Ellen Stewart – Director

Vincent Price – Actor

Eric Bentley – Critic

Megan Terry – Playwright

Judith Jameson – Dancer

Alvin Ailey – Dancer

Arnold Moss – Actor

Edward Viella – Dancer

Earl Wilson, Jr. – Composer/Playwright/Performer

Siobhan McKenna – actor

Emlyn Williams – Actor/Playwright

David Hare – Playwright

Open Theater Acting Company

Performance Group – Spaulding Gray, Elizabeth LeCompte
